Gopher Softball Games Against Iowa Cancelled
4/6/2007 12:00:00 AM | Softball
Due to unplayable field conditions, Minnesota's softball games against Iowa have been cancelled, this following a decision earlier in the day to move Friday's game to Saturday. The series against the Hawkeyes will not be rescheduled.
The Gophers have now had their last four games cancelled (doubleheaders at Penn State, 4/11, and vs. Iowa, 4/7).
Minnesota's 2007 home opener is now scheduled for Sunday, a doubleheader against Illinois beginning at noon. A decision on whether Sunday's games will be played as scheduled will be made after 2:30 p.m. tomorrow. The decision, however, could be made as late as game time on Sunday.
